In testing Format Factory 5.9, the conversion speeds are impressive for a free tool. It utilizes hardware acceleration (GPU) effectively if your graphics card supports it. A standard 2GB MP4 video conversion took roughly 3 minutes on a mid-range machine, which is competitive with premium paid software. The output quality is generally indistinguishable from the source for standard conversions, though heavy compression can result in artifacting—but that is to be expected.

When downloading Format Factory 5.9, always ensure you are using the official website or a trusted repository. Since it is free software, some third-party installers may bundle "Optional Offers" (adware); always select "Custom Install" to decline any extra software you don't want.

Format Factory 5.9 is a robust, free multimedia conversion tool for Windows that streamlines the process of transforming video, audio, and image files into compatible formats. Released on November 15, 2021, this version introduced significant updates to its core engine and added creative filters for more advanced media processing. Key Features of Version 5.9
The 5.9 update focused on both performance improvements and new functional tools:
Updated Engine: Integrated the latest FFMPEG 4.4 encoder for better efficiency and broader format support.
Hardware Acceleration: Added support for the QSV vp9 HA encoder, which uses your computer's hardware to speed up the conversion process.
Creative Filters: Introduced filters for video anti-shake, noise reduction, and reverse play, as well as echo and noise reduction for audio.
Media Enhancement: Added a "Video & Photo optimize" feature and a music library for the "Add Music" function during video conversion.
Document Tools: Introduced automatic compression after merging PDF files. How to Use Format Factory 5.9 for Media Conversion

, a popular freeware multimedia converter. User feedback regarding this version is mixed, with some users reporting it functions as expected while others experience technical issues. Key Performance Feedback Functional Reports
: Many users find that Format Factory 5.9 continues to offer its core range of features, including converting, mixing, and joining video and audio clips. Startup Issues : On technical forums like
, some users have reported that while older versions worked flawlessly, newer updates like 5.9.0 have refused to execute or start on certain systems. Ease of Use
: Reviewers often highlight its intuitive "drag and drop" interface and the ability to batch-process multiple files simultaneously. Reliability and Security Concerns Safety Warnings
: Some security software and browsers may flag the Format Factory installer as a threat. This is often due to the installer being "ad-supported" or bundled with additional software (sometimes referred to as "crapware") rather than being traditional malware. Offline Functionality
: A noted benefit is the ability to convert files offline, which keeps content private compared to online conversion tools. Comodo Forum Popular Alternatives
